Juventus have received almost universal praise for their stunning swoop of Fiorentina striker Dusan Vlahović and Bianconeri hero Gianluigi Buffon is the latest to wax lyrical over the move.

Buffon, who left Juve for a second time in the summer as he returned to Serie B outfit Parma, is today celebrating his 44th birthday. Tanti Auguri, Gigi!

The veteran has continued to defy time this season as he’s started all of Parma’s 19 Serie B games thus far, conceding a respectable 22 times. He departed Juve in the summer having amassed 685 appearances for the Old Lady (second-most all-time) and winning ten Scudetti. During his two-decade-long spell in Turin, the goalkeeping icon played with some of the all-time greats including Alessandro Del Piero and Cristiano Ronaldo.

And in a recent interview with La Gazzetta Dello Sport, Buffon piled on the praise for a 21-year-old who has the potential to forge his own legacy in Turin (not to put the pressure on, or anything!).

After a quiet opening three weeks to the January transfer window, Juventus swooped almost out of nowhere to reach an agreement with Fiorentina for Vlahović. The deal, worth €75m, was wrapped up on Thursday night and the Serbian striker arrived at J-Medical on Friday to complete his medical.

An official announcement is expected soon.

Like all of us, Buffon was “surprised” at Juventus’ big-money move for Vlahović but described the signing as “beautiful”.

“With [Erling Braut] Haaland and [Kylian] Mbappe, he is the best youngster in the world,” the Italian legend added. “He has something different, the presence of a big #9. And then it is an evolution: in my time there were no 1.90m players with such dynamism.”
